And these birds aren't just dying off on the periphery of their territory:
most of their communities are dying off in the middle of their prime habitats.Between 1970 and 2017, the continent had
already lost upwards of 3 million birds. But the disturbing trend has only
continued and worsened since then.
A multitude of culprits have contributed to this problem. Climate change is changing and disrupting their food sources and breeding grounds. Human development projects - including clearing land for farms - are tearing down their ecosystems. And pesticide use is poisoning them.
